The Biosafety Level (BSL)-3 lab at Naga Hospital Authority Kohima (NHAK) has been completed few days ago and awaiting approval from ICMR, a state health official informed today.

 

The BSL-3 in NHAK is completed and the documentation to the Indian Council for Medical Research (ICMR) is awaited for approval, Secretary, Health & Family Welfare (H&FW) Kesonyü Yhome told the The Morung Express on Sunday.

 

As the construction agency with adequate qualification and expertise is vital in the construction of the BSL kabs, the Thermo Fisher Scientific, Guwahati has been hired as the construction agency of the BSL-3 and BSL-2 in Kohima and Dimapur respectively, he said.

 

A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) of Annual Maintenance Contract (AMC) has been signed with Thermo Fisher Scientific for a period of three years with two years free maintenance of the facilities.
